Problem
There's this legacy API that contains info gathered across decades of existence. Your team needs to use one of the endpoints of that API to build a new web app.
The problem is that this specific endpoint returns millions of items, paginated at 100 per page.
Since you will need more flexibility in terms of page size, your team decides to build a frontend for this legacy API that will allow a user defined value for the number of items per page.
You'll be in charge of this task.
Here's what you need to do:
- Create a simple API with just one required endpoint:
GET /items. - This new API will return the list of items of the legacy API, but will accept a
pageandperPagearguments returning accordingly.
Here's what you need to know:
- The legacy API is at http://sf-legacy-api.now.sh
- A simple
GET /itemswill return the first 100 items. - To go to a specific page you use
GET /items?page=20for instance. - The response will contain info about the total number of items, and the link to the next page.
